Iowa Code § 189.26

Refusal to act
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
Ifthecounty attorney refusesto act, the governor may, in thegovernor’s discretion, appoint an attorney to represent the state. [S13, §4999-a19; C24, 27, 31, 35, 39, §3052; C46, 50, 54, 58, 62, 66, §189.24; C71, 73, 75, 77, 79, 81, §189.26]
